About This Item
New York: Charles Scribner's Sons, 1926. Third Edition. Hardcover. Good. wear to spine tops & corners. both volumes textblocks detached; split, but pgs intact. both volumes have rattled hinges & spines. foxing to upper-textblock; splotched foxing along upper edges of pgs, otherwise, pgs nice&bright.. 2 vols. Burgundy cloth, gilt letters on spine, stamped decoration on front cover, (xxiv, 398 pp. and xx, 354 pp.). 1000+ bw plates. An affordable reading copy of this classic two-volume set. Vol. I has an eighteen-page introduction followed by the following chapters: Chests, Chests of Drawers, Cupboards and Sideboards, Desks and Scrutories, Looking-Glasses. Vol. II has the following chapters: Chairs; Settees, Couches and Sofas; Tables; Bedsteads; and Clocks. The prolific illustrations add a great deal to this excellent reference. This third edition has supplementary chapters and one hundred and thirty six additional plates. Shipping weight is 12 pounds.
